1.
A theoretical substance which would confer eternal life on the drinker.

2.
A preparation consisting of gold particles in oil and alcohol.

词源
From potable + gold. From being something drinkable that is like gold. * (alchemy): from being an elixir that confers the untarnishability and eternity of gold to a person
